Output 83f348c5e273764eca3663cad336632f4fb05602d74739774c0677d88d1683e5:7

value
76685924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ca734780b9199d6a26c53783e9ae54dfd63afcc4 OP_EQUAL
address
MSMcpvhZQvPXLi6tDxaXNuv2Ewo29aVZEZ
transaction
83f348c5e273764eca3663cad336632f4fb05602d74739774c0677d88d1683e5
spent
true